As we approach the end of 2024, the landscape of integrations for Xero continues to evolve, offering users enhanced functionality and streamlined workflows. HereтАЩs a closer look at the top 10 integrations that can maximize your Xero experience.
1. HubSpot
Connecting Xero with HubSpot can turn your customer relationship management into a powerhouse. This integration allows you to sync contacts, manage invoices, and track payments directly within HubSpot. With automated workflows, you can nurture leads and close deals while keeping your financials updated in Xero, ensuring both sales and accounting teams operate off the same data.
2. Stripe
For businesses that rely on online transactions, integrating Stripe with Xero is a game-changer. This setup allows seamless payment processing, where every transaction processed via Stripe is automatically recorded in Xero. You can effortlessly track payments, manage refunds, and simplify reconciliation, all while ensuring your financial reports are up to date.
3. Shopify
If you run an eCommerce store, linking Xero with Shopify streamlines your operations by syncing sales data, customer information, and inventory levels in real-time. This integration helps reduce manual entry, minimizes errors, and provides insightful reports on both sales and financial health, thus enhancing decision-making.
4. PayPal
Integrating PayPal with Xero simplifies payment processing for businesses that have this online payment method as their primary channel. Automatically import PayPal transactions into Xero, ensuring accurate record-keeping. This integration keeps track of sales, expenses, and recurring payments effortlessly, making financial management smoother.
5. Cin7
Cin7 is a powerful inventory management tool that can integrate directly with Xero. This connection allows businesses to manage their inventory smoothly while synchronizing sales orders, tracking products, and generating detailed reports. With real-time updates, you maintain accurate accounts without the hassle of double entries.
6. Receipt Bank
Receipt Bank is a favorite among accountants and small business owners for managing expenses. By connecting this tool with Xero, users can automate the processing of receipts and bills. Uploading receipts through the app will extract data, allowing you to approve and sync expenses with Xero instantly. This not only saves time but enhances accuracy in expense reporting.
7. Gusto
For businesses seeking efficient payroll management, GustoтАЩs integration with Xero allows for easy payroll processing and tax management. This connection ensures payroll data syncs seamlessly with Xero, maintaining accurate financial records and simplifying compliance. It automates various payroll tasks, making it a must-have for HR departments.
8. WorkflowMax
WorkflowMax is an end-to-end project management tool that integrates with Xero to enhance both time tracking and invoicing. By linking these two applications, users can manage projects, allocate resources, and invoice clients directly based on project work hours. This integration helps in improving project profitability and reduces admin overhead.
9. Latenode
Latenode provides a no-code platform that allows users to create custom workflows and integrations between Xero and other applications. This flexibility enables you to automate repetitive tasks and enhance your operational efficiency without needing extensive programming knowledge. By leveraging Latenode, businesses can build tailored solutions that suit their unique requirements whilst keeping financial data synced with Xero.
10. Salesforce
Integrating Salesforce with Xero can revolutionize your sales and accounting teamsтАЩ collaboration. This integration allows you to sync customer data, invoices, and payment histories, creating a comprehensive view of customer interactions across both platforms. It automates follow-ups and ensures that sales data aligns with financial records, enhancing customer service and business intelligence.
